Title: Vase Composition XI'25

This piece is a quiet composition of form and texture, where matter becomes language.

Soft volumes emerge from a hand-stitched surface, suggesting vessels, spaces, and absences rather than defining them. The restrained palette—earth, sand, and muted tones—invites stillness, allowing the eye to rest and wander.

Each thread follows a deliberate rhythm, building a subtle relief that interacts gently with light, revealing depth through shadow rather than contrast.

Rooted in Japandi and wabi-sabi sensibilities, the work embraces imperfection, balance, and the beauty of the understated.

It is not meant to dominate a space, but to inhabit it quietly—bringing warmth, calm, and a sense of grounded presence.
A tactile artwork to be experienced slowly.

Every inch of this composition is hand-tufted using a precision punch-needle technique. I use a curated blend of premium Alpaca wool and organic cotton, chosen for their ability to hold light and shadow differently.
• The Medium: Hand-tufted fiber art (Punch Needle)
• The Frame: Housed in a professional, gallery-grade frame that anchors the softness of the textile with a sharp, modern edge.
